Peekskill Middle School Gains $926,311 State Grant

Agency - New York State Education Department

Peekskill Middle School fetches a 21st Century Community Learning Centers Grant Award worth $926,311 from the state Education Department.


The 21st Century Community Learning Grant will be used to enable all students to improve their academic and social skills for college and future careers, says LEAP Coordinator Naima Smith Moore.

Establishing a Social Enterprise Curriculum


Several British colleges and universities have embraced social entrepreneurship in their curriculum. Pathik Pathak at Southampton have introduced n interdisciplinary module in Social Enterprise, which is open to students of all year groups and across all disciplines.
